1、When there is a braking failure on a downhill road, if there is no favorable terrain or opportunity to stop the vehicle, the driver should drop gear by one position or two positions, and control the speed by taking advantage of the braking role of the engine.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A
2、Mr. Tang drove a large bus with 74 passengers (capacity 30 people). When descending a long curving slope at a speed of 38 kilometers per hour, the bus overturned to a brook beside the road. As a result of the accident, 17 people were killed and 57 people injured. What is the main illegal act committed by Mr. Tang?
A. Driving after drinking
B. Carrying more passengers than permitted
C. Fatigued driving
D. Speeding
Answer:BD
3、Driving and smoking has no negative effect on safe driving
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B

10、Which of the following is a basic requirement for rescuing the injured at the scene of a traffic accident?
A. Treat wounds first and safe life later
B. Save life first and treat wounds later
C. Help lightly wounded persons first
D. Help seriously wounded persons later
Answer:B

15、When a motor vehicle enters an expressway from the ramp, which of the following lamps should be turned on?
A. The left-turn indicator
B. The right-turn indicator
C. The hazard warning lamp
D. The headlamp
Answer:A
